Description
(Local Name: Musée du fer et du chemin de fer) The Museum of Iron explains the development of the iron industry through demonstrations by blacksmiths using actual forges driven by the hydraulic power of four waterwheels.

The Museum of the Railroad recalls the history of Vallorbe as an important stop on the Simplon-Orient-Express rail journey with exhibits covering the first steam engines to the high-speed train, the TGV.
